Applies to end systems concerned with operation in the Open Systems Interconnection (OSI) environment. Defines a combination of OSI standards which together give the connection-mode Transport service by means of the connection-mode Network Service. Applies to the providing of the connection-mode Transport Service in end systems attached to any sort of subnetwork from which the standardized connection-mode Network Service is made available.
